The Silverado Resort, located on a 1,200-acre estate in Napa Valley, was originally built in the 1870s by General John Franklin Miller. Legend says Miller built the elegant 14-room mansion around a pre-existing Spanish adobe cottage to avoid bad luck. Since welcoming guests in 1966, Silverado has become a popular vacation and conference destination, offering 36 holes of golf, a spa, fitness center, and 12 hard tennis courts.
